"Vandalism to me is basically anger,” Dr. Jeffery Chase, a licensed clinical psychologist and psychology professor at Radford University in Radford, Va., said. "It can be displacement — displacement in the technical sense is that [vandals] wish to do something against a more threatening object or individual, so they vent their anger on something safer."

One of the moderators of the subreddit, DoxBox, also shares this opinion. "Mild vandalism is vandalism that is humorous but not overly damaging," they told Bored Panda. "Regular vandalism is costly to fix and malicious in intent. The sub is about mostly-harmless but humorous vandalism intended to make people laugh."
His colleague, fellow moderator awesomesprime, pointed out that important urgent matters get represented in the subreddit, too. Like, the presidential election. "Recently, political posts have been at the top, but [they still] have to be funny and clever. Those seem to be the ones that make it the highest," they said.
A Realtor You Can Depend On
"Posts do well the funnier they are, with the caveat that Reddit's usual issues do sometimes interfere. Posting the same post at different times can have different results," DoxBox added, explaining the main differences on why some pics go viral and some don't.

Getty tried to cash $120 from an artist for the use of one of their stockphoto's. In return the artist slammed a $1billion lawsuit in a in copyright complaint. The artist Carol Highsmith donated her images to the Library of Congress for free public use. Getty was charging her fees for the use of her own work. It seems that Getty copyrights a lot of pictures that are released in the public domain and charges people for the use of them. Lesson to be learned: Check your pictures before paying copyright fees to Getty.
